DescriptionCVE.org

Use after free in SignIn in Google Chrome prior to 150.0.7871.47 allowed a remote attacker who convinced a user to engage in specific UI gestures to potentially exploit heap corruption via a crafted HTML page. (Chromium security severity: Low)

AnalysisAI

Use-after-free in Google Chrome's SignIn component (versions prior to 150.0.7871.47) allows a remote attacker to trigger heap corruption and potentially achieve code execution after luring a victim to a crafted HTML page and performing specific UI gestures. No public exploit was identified at time of analysis, and with an EPSS of 0.17% (7th percentile) and Chromium-rated 'Low' severity, near-term mass exploitation appears unlikely despite the high 8.8 CVSS. The flaw is patched in the current stable channel and is not listed in CISA KEV.

Technical ContextAI

The vulnerability is a CWE-416 Use-After-Free in Chrome's SignIn subsystem, the browser-side component that manages Google account authentication, profile linkage, and sync sign-in flows. A use-after-free occurs when a heap object is freed but a dangling pointer to it is later dereferenced; in a renderer/browser context this lets an attacker reclaim the freed allocation with attacker-controlled data, corrupting the heap and enabling control-flow hijacking. Chrome is built on the Chromium engine (Blink rendering, V8 JavaScript), so the same defect affects other Chromium-derived browsers that share the code (e.g., Edge, Brave, Opera) until they pick up the upstream fix. The internal Chromium tracker issues.chromium.org/issues/361375787 corresponds to this bug; affected component is SignIn per the vendor's own attribution (chrome-cve-admin@google.com).

RemediationAI

Vendor-released patch: update Google Chrome to 150.0.7871.47 or later via the Chrome Releases Stable channel update (https://chromereleases.googleblog.com/2026/06/stable-channel-update-for-desktop_0175352312.html). In managed environments, confirm auto-update is enabled and force a relaunch so the new binary loads, since Chrome only applies pending updates on restart; verify via chrome://settings/help. Users of other Chromium-based browsers should apply their vendor's build once it incorporates the upstream fix. If patching must be deferred, the practical compensating control for this SignIn use-after-free is user-behavior and exposure reduction: because exploitation requires the victim to visit attacker-controlled HTML and perform specific UI gestures, restrict browsing to trusted sites, enable enterprise policies that limit navigation, and consider disabling/limiting the browser sign-in flow via policy (e.g., BrowserSignin) where feasible - the trade-off is loss of profile sync convenience. There is no fully equivalent workaround to patching; these controls only reduce the interaction surface, not eliminate the defect.
